I have always loved the saxophone and worked my way back into Lester Young's music from John Coltrane and Charlie Parker. There is something sped up about both Coltrane and Parker that you don't find in Lester. Lester was cool, laid back, soulful. This collection captures that side of him well. I don't believe it's chronological or inclusive of all of Lester's periods (because he had many and he played differently in each) and there are no Billie Holiday companion pieces but you can't go wrong with this beautiful music.
